Role Duties and Responsibilities:
In this role, the Executive Assistant will provide comprehensive administrative support to our CEO and the Executive Leadership Team (ELT). This role will play a critical part in managing the CEO's/ELT’s schedules, coordinating meetings and travel arrangements, and ensuring the smooth operation of executive-level activities. You will act as a trusted partner to the CEO, handling highly sensitive and confidential information with the utmost discretion and professionalism. This position requires exceptional organizational skills, strong attention to detail, and the ability to thrive in a fast-paced, dynamic environment.
CEO Support:
Manage the CEO's calendar, schedule appointments, and coordinate meetings, both internal and external, ensuring efficient time management.
Prepare and organize materials for meetings, presentations, and conferences, ensuring accuracy and professionalism.
Handle travel arrangements, including booking flights, hotels, and ground transportation, and managing travel itineraries.
Screen and prioritize incoming communications, including emails, phone calls, and mail, and respond or redirect as appropriate.
Draft and edit correspondence, memos, reports, and other documents, maintaining an elevated level of accuracy and great attention to detail.
Maintain strict confidentiality and oversee sensitive information with discretion.
Executive Leadership Team Support:
Assist the ELT members with calendar management, meeting coordination, and preparation of materials.
Coordinate and schedule ELT meetings, ensuring all necessary participants are included and meeting coordination is arranged.
Take minutes and distribute meeting notes, tracking action items and follow-ups.
Provide administrative support for ELT-related projects and initiatives, including research, data analysis, and report preparation.
Facilitate effective communication between the ELT members and other stakeholders, both internal and external.
Office Management:
Oversee the smooth operation of the CEO's office, ensuring supplies are stocked, equipment is functional, and facilities are well-maintained.
Process expense reports and manage invoices and reimbursements.
Coordinate planning for corporate events, conferences, and off-site meetings.
Manage confidential files and documents, ensuring proper organization, compliance, filing, and accessibility.
Special Projects:
Assist the CEO and ELT members with special projects and initiatives, providing research, analysis, and support as needed.
Collaborate with cross-functional teams to drive projects forward and meet deadlines.
